CSS - caption-side Property
The caption-side property specifies where the table caption should be displayed (top or bottom).
Possible Values
top − Places the caption's element box above the table box.
bottom − Places the caption's element box below the table box.
Applies to
All the HTML positioned element.
DOM Syntax
object.style.captionSide = "top";
Example
Here is the example showing the usage of this property −
<html> <head> <style> caption.top {caption-side: top} caption.bottom {caption-side: bottom} </style> </head> <body> <div> <h2>caption-side: top</h2> <table style = "width: 400px; border: 2px solid black;"> <caption class = "top"> This caption will appear at the top of the table. </caption> <tr><td >Data 1</td></tr> <tr><td >Data 2</td></tr> </table> </div> <div> <h2>caption-side: bottom</h2> <table style = "width: 400px; border: 2px solid black;"> <caption class = "bottom"> This caption will appear at the bottom of the table. </caption> <tr><td >Data 1</td></tr> <tr><td >Data 2</td></tr> </table> </div> </body> </html>
